west ham united
boleyn ground (upton park)
Wednesday 27th April 1994, Premier League, West Ham United take on Blackburn Rovers who only needed a point to guarantee a second place finish, Rovers started the game strong and took the lead early on with a goal from Henning Berg, the game was end to end with chances for both sides, Allen equaling things just after the hour mark, Ian Pearce came off the bench on 73 minutes and turned the game in Rovers favour within a minute, the ended 2 1 tp Rovers, still running Manchester United close for the title, least Rovers could now expect was a second place finish.
WEST HAM: Miklosko, Potts, Brown, Breacker, Gale, Allen, Holmes (sub Mitchell), Bishop, Rush (sub Chapman), Marsh, Morley
BLACKBURN: Flowers, Berg, May, Hendry, Wright (sub Pearce), Le Saux, Sherwood, Ripley (sub Morrison), Wilcox, Atkins, Shearer
ATTENDANCE: 22,186
